Cardiovascular telerehabilitation improves functional capacity, cardiorespiratory fitness and quality of life in older adults: A systematic review and meta-analysis.

Diego NacaratoAmanda Veiga SardeliLilian O MarianoMara Patrícia T Chacon-Mikahil
Published in: Journal of telemedicine and telecare (2022)
CV-T-REHAB improved cardiorespiratory fitness to a level equal to or higher than CV-P-REHAB and improved functional capacity and QoL; being mainly effective for QoL in older adults >65 years. Thus, CV-T-REHAB can be a good alternative, when not the best option and might be considered especially for individuals with limited access to participate in face-to-face programs.
